BERLIN. — Pep Guardiola has said Bayern Munich will only beat Real Madrid in Wednesday’s Champions League soccer semi-final with a vastly improved display after their lacklustre Bundesliga win at bottom-side Eintracht Braunschweig.
European champions Bayern ended a run of three Bundesliga games without victory with an unimpressive 2-0 win at Braunschweig on Saturday, four days before their semi-final, first-leg at Madrid’s Bernabeu.

“We won’t reach the Champions League final unless we put in a commanding performance against Real Madrid,” said Guardiola. “It’s not been easy for us after winning the German title, but we fought despite a difficult situation.” Having beaten Real in a penalty shoot-out in the 2012 Champions League semi-finals, Bayern have been dubbed “la bestia negra” — black beasts — by Real fans, but chairman Karl-Heinz Rummenigge said they must prove themselves. — AFP.
